272 Provincial Court Proceedings, 1674. Liber M M ents the receipt whereof the said Daniel doth hereby acknowledge and thereof and of every part and parcell thereof doth clearely and absolutely acquitt exonerate and discharge him the said Thomas Courtney his executors and administrators by these presents and for divers other good causes and Valuable considerations him thereunto moveing hath given granted aliened sold enfeoffed and confirmed and by these presents doth give grant alien sell enfeoff and confirme unto the said Thomas Courtney his heirs and assignes for ever all that tract parcell or Devident of Land called or Knowne by the name of Come-Away lyeing in St Maries County and begining at a marked red Oake neere a marsh by the Bay called Clockers marsh and runing South for bredth thirty perches to a marsh called Come- away marsh and from the said marked Oake by a line drawne south west for three hundred and foure perches to a marked Oake and from the said marked Oake for breadth into the woods by a line drawne northwest and by north One hundred perches to a marked Oake and from the said Oake by a line east and by north to the first redd Oake two hundred and eighty perches Containeing by estimation One hundred Acres more or lesse with all and every the Lands tenements houses buildings edifices gardens Orchards pastures p. 199 rights members and appurtenñcs to the said parcell of Land belong ing or any wayes apparteineing together with all Deeds evidences Patents grants Charters escripts writeings and minimts whatsoever of or concerning the Same To have and to hold the said Land and premises to the Only proper use and behoofe of him the said Thomas Courtney his heirs and assignes forever And the Said Daniel doth hereby for himselfe his heirs executors and administrs Covenant and agree to and with the said Thomas Courtney his heirs executors and administrators that he the said Daniel at the ensealeing and delivery of these presents is and doth stand seized of the said Land and premisses with their appurtenfices of a firme good Sure and undefeasible estate of inheritance in ifee Simple and that he hath good right and full power and law full authority to grant bargaine and sell the Same to him the said Thomas Courtney and his heirs and that he will for ever warrant and defend the same to him the said Thomas Courtney and his heirs against all persons whatsoever claimeing by from or under him the said Daniel his heirs executors and administrators and also from all claime and claimes of Dower made or hereafter to be made by Ann his now wife or any person or persons claimeing by from or under her or to her use or by her procurement for or in the nature of dower joynture or settlement upon Marriage or after and that the said Land and premisses are free and cleere of all manner of incumbrances whatsoever the rents and services due and payable to the Lord Proprietary and his heirs Lord and Lords of the ifee of the premisses alwayes excepted and foreprized And the Said Daniel doth further for himselfe his heirs |
